THE WORLD'S BEST CHOCOLATE OATMEAL CAKE



The World's Best Chocolate Oatmeal Cake image

This world's best chocolate oatmeal cake recipe is from my coworker's grandma. Made with chocolate chips, cocoa, and oatmeal, topped with fudge frosting.

Provided by Pinch of Yum, recipe from Mimi's Grandma

Categories     Dessert

Time 1h

Yield 20

Number Of Ingredients 16

1 cup brown sugar
1 cup white sugar
1/2 cup butter, melted
2 eggs, lightly beaten with fork
1 3/4 cups flour
1 teaspoon baking soda
1/2 teaspoon salt
1 1/2 tablespoons unsweetened cocoa powder
1 cup quick cooking oats*
1 3/4 cups boiling water
1 12 oz bag chocolate chips, divided (go for the Ghirardelli*)
6 tablespoons butter
6 tablespoons milk
1 1/2 cups sugar
1/2-3/4 cup chocolate chips (Ghirardelli again, please)
1/2-3/4 cup mini marshmallows*

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350. With an electric mixer, cream the butter and sugars. Add the eggs and mix well.
  • Add flour, soda, salt and cocoa and mix until just incorporated. The batter will be very thick.
  • Add water to oatmeal and let stand for a few minutes. Once oats are soft, add oats/water mixture to the batter and mix well. Stir in half of the bag of chocolate chips (6 ounces).
  • Pour into a greased or buttered rectangular 9×13 cake pan. Sprinkle the top of the cake with the rest of the bag of chocolate chips (6 ounces).
  • Bake at 350 for 30-40 minutes or until the surface springs back lightly when touched and your house smells amazing. Do not overbake. Let cool completely.
  • For the frosting, melt the butter, sugar, and milk in a large saucepan over medium-low heat. Bring to a boil and boil for 30 seconds.
  • Reduce heat to low and add chocolate chips and marshmallows. Stir or whisk until frosting is smooth. Pour immediately over the cooled cake. The frosting crystallizes almost immediately as it cools so it's important to get it on the cake while it's still piping hot. Allow the frosted cake to cool for 5 minutes before serving. Or... not.

EASY CHOCOLATE OATMEAL CAKE



Easy Chocolate Oatmeal Cake image

Make and share this Easy Chocolate Oatmeal Cake recipe from Food.com.

Provided by Molly53

Categories     Dessert

Time 55m

Yield 12 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 11

1/2 cup rolled oats
1/2 cup butter
1 cup boiling water
1 1/2 cups brown sugar
2 eggs, beaten
1 teaspoon vanilla
1 cup flour
1 teaspoon baking soda
1 teaspoon baking powder
1/2 teaspoon salt
4 tablespoons cocoa

Steps:

  • Grease an 8 x 8 pan.
  • Mix oats, boiling water, and butter.
  • Let cool.
  • Beat sugar, eggs and vanilla.
  • Add cooled oat mixture to sugar/egg mixture.
  • Sift the dry ingredients together.
  • Add to the wet mixture and mix well.
  • Spread into the prepared pan.
  • Bake at 350 for 40 minutes.

KIDS CAN MAKE: OATMEAL-CHOCOLATE SNACK CAKES



Kids Can Make: Oatmeal-Chocolate Snack Cakes image

These delightful treats have a soft, tender crumb that harks back to old-fashioned snack cakes from the grocery store. For little kids: Let them dump the ingredients into the mixing bowls, whisk together the dry ingredients and stir in the chocolate chips. For big kids: Let them measure out the ingredients, spray the baking pan with cooking spray and help spread the batter in the baking pan.

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Time 1h5m

Yield 12 snack cakes

Number Of Ingredients 10

Cooking spray
1 cup whole-wheat pastry flour
3/4 cup rolled oats
1/2 teaspoon baking soda
1/4 teaspoon kosher salt
6 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ted and slightly cooled
1 large egg
3/4 cup packed light brown sugar* (See Cook's Note)
1/2 cup unsweetened applesauce
3/4 cup semisweet mini chocolate chips

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F. Line the bottom of a 9-inch square baking pan with a foil strip long enough to overhang on 2 opposite sides. Spray the foil lightly with cooking spray; set aside.
  • Whisk together the flour, oats, baking soda and salt in a medium bowl; set aside. Whisk the butter, egg, brown sugar and applesauce in a large bowl until combined. Add the dry ingredients to the wet and mix until barely mixed. Stir in the chocolate chips.
  • Spread the batter in the prepared baking pan. Bake until the cake is light brown around the edges and a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ean, 25 to 30 minutes. Remove from the oven and let cool on a rack for 15 minutes. Use the foil overhang to lift the cake out of the pan and let cool completely on the rack. Invert onto a plate and peel the foil off. Re-invert the cake onto a cutting board, cut into 12 pieces and serve.

NAN'S OATMEAL CHOCOLATE CAKE



Nan's Oatmeal Chocolate Cake image

This is moist cake and I love the texture. This was my Nanny's recipe now my kids love it. I like that it's in a 8+8 pan, or cupcakes.

Provided by smclarke

Categories     Dessert

Time 50m

Yield 1 cake, 6-9 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 10

1/2 cup margarine or 1/2 cup butter
1 3/4 cups brown sugar
2 eggs
1 teaspoon vanilla
1 cup flour
1/4 teaspoon salt
3 tablespoons spoon cocoa
1 teaspoon baking soda
1 cup hot water
1/2 cup oats

Steps:

  • Add the hot water to the oats in a small bowl and set aside.
  • Cream marg, brown sugar, vanilla and eggs.
  • Sift flour, salt, coca and soda.
  • Add the oats the the butter mixture.
  • Add the dry ingredients to the wet.
  • Pour into a 8-8 greased and floured pan.
  • Bake @ 350 for 30-35 minute.

CHOCOLATE OATMEAL SNACK CAKE



Chocolate Oatmeal Snack Cake image

I would make this for my daughters as an afterschool treat. It produces a moist, dense, delicious cake. Since it's baked in a 9x9 pan, there's not a whole lot of cake around to tempt me for too long! Make your own frosting or use store-bought. Or simply dust it powdered sugar!

Provided by HisPixie

Categories     Dessert

Time 50m

Yield 1 cake, 10 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 cup quick-cooking oats
8 tablespoons margarine
1 1/2 cups water, boiling
2 eggs
1/2 cup cocoa
1 cup flour
1 1/2 cups sugar
1 teaspoon baking soda
1/2 teaspoon salt

Steps:

  • In a medium bowl, place the oats and the margarine.
  • Pour the boiling water over the oats & margarine and allow to sit for 20 minutes.
  • Add the eggs to the oatmeal mixture and blend together.
  • Sift together the dry ingredients and add to the wet mixture; stir well.
  • Pour into a greased 9x9 cake pan and bake at 375 degrees for 25 to 30 minutes or until cake tests done.
  • Cool completely and frost.

CHOCOLATE OATMEAL CAKE



Chocolate Oatmeal Cake image

Writes Deborah Sheehan of East Orland, Maine, "Chocolate Oatmeal Cake is a treat-it's so moist and is topped with scrumptious coffee frosting."

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 55m

Yield 12 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 17

1-1/2 cups boiling water
1 cup quick-cooking oats
1 cup semisweet chocolate chips
1/2 cup butter, softened
3/4 cup sugar
3/4 cup packed brown sugar
2 large eggs
1-1/2 cups all-purpose flour
1 teaspoon baking soda
1 teaspoon salt
COFFEE FROSTING:
2 teaspoons instant coffee granules
1/4 cup half-and-half cream, warmed
1/2 cup butter, softened
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1/8 teaspoon salt
4 cups confectioners' sugar

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, combine water and oats. Sprinkle with chocolate chips (do not stir); let stand for 20 minutes. , In a large bowl, cream butter and sugars until light and fluffy. Add eggs, one at a time, beating well after each addition. Beat in oat mixture. Combine flour, baking soda and salt; add to the creamed mixture and mix well. , Pour into a greased 13x9-in. baking pan. Bake at 350° for 35-40 minutes or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ean. Cool on a wire rack., For frosting, dissolve coffee granules in cream; set aside. In a large bowl, beat butter until smooth. Beat in vanilla and salt. Gradually beat in confectioners' sugar until smooth. Beat in enough of the coffee mixture to achieve spreading consistency. Frost cake.

CHOCOLATE OATMEAL CAKE



Chocolate Oatmeal Cake image

This is an easy and wholesome cake to bake.

Provided by Brenda Moore

Categories     Desserts     Cakes     Holiday Cake Recipes

Yield 12

Number Of Ingredients 11

½ cup rolled oats
½ cup butter
1 cup boiling water
1 ½ cups packed brown sugar
2 eggs, beaten
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1 cup all-purpose flour
1 teaspoon baking soda
1 teaspoon baking powder
½ teaspoon salt
4 tablespoons cocoa

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Grease one 8x8 inch pan.
  • In a large bowl, mix together the rolled oats and butter. Mix in boiling water. Set aside to cool.
  • Beat together the brown sugar, eggs and vanilla; add to cooled oat mixture and mix well.
  • Sift together the flour, baking soda, baking powder, salt and cocoa. Add to wet ingredients and mix well. Spread into the prepared pan.
  • Bake at 350 degrees F (175 degrees C) for 40 minutes. Remove from oven, allow to cool, and remove pan.

OATMEAL CHOCOLATE CAKE



Oatmeal Chocolate Cake image

I've had this recipe a long time. It's one of my family's favorite desserts, and I still make it often.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 40m

Yield 15 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 16

1 cup old-fashioned oats
1-1/2 cups boiling water
1/2 cup butter, softened
1-1/2 cups sugar
2 large eggs
1-1/2 cups all-purpose flour
1/2 cup baking cocoa
1-1/2 teaspoons baking soda
1/2 teaspoon salt
TOPPING:
2/3 cup packed brown sugar
1/2 cup plus 1 tablespoon butter, melted
1-1/2 cups sweetened shredded coconut
3/4 cup chopped walnuts
6 tablespoons half-and-half cream
1-1/2 teaspoons vanilla extract

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, combine the oats and boiling water. Let stand for 15 minutes or until cooled. , In another large bowl, cream butter and sugar until light and fluffy. Add eggs, one at a time, beating well after each addition. Add the oat mixture; mix well. Combine the flour, cocoa, baking soda and salt; add to creamed mixture and mix well., Transfer to a greased 13x9-in. baking pan. Bake at 350° for 30-35 minutes or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ean. , Combine the topping ingredients; spoon over top of warm cake; broil about 4 in. from heat for 3-4 minutes, or until top is lightly browned.
